新聞中心
Redis:缺乏強勁的源動力

成都創(chuàng)新互聯(lián)公司是一家以網(wǎng)站建設、網(wǎng)頁設計、品牌設計、軟件運維、成都網(wǎng)站推廣、小程序App開發(fā)等移動開發(fā)為一體互聯(lián)網(wǎng)公司。已累計為成都宣傳片制作等眾行業(yè)中小客戶提供優(yōu)質的互聯(lián)網(wǎng)建站和軟件開發(fā)服務。
Redis是一個高性能的鍵值對存儲系統(tǒng),廣泛用于緩存、消息隊列、計數(shù)器等場景。它是按照內存操作的,可持久化的存儲系統(tǒng)。 Redis的功能強大,但是也存在一些問題。本文主要討論Redis缺乏強勁的源動力的問題。
一、Redis的存儲引擎不夠穩(wěn)定
Redis的存儲引擎不夠穩(wěn)定,容易出現(xiàn)數(shù)據(jù)丟失和不一致的情況。若出現(xiàn)讀、寫不一致的問題,一種解決方法是關閉Redis的自動快照功能。但是,這會增加Redis的單點故障率,進一步減弱了Redis的可靠性。
二、Redis缺乏分布式特性
Redis是一個單機模式的數(shù)據(jù)庫,分布式特性非常弱。它對于分布式部署的支持程度很低,不能實現(xiàn)數(shù)據(jù)的自動復制、數(shù)據(jù)的分區(qū)和負載均衡等功能。 這也就是說,Redis目前缺乏高可用性和可擴展性。
三、Redis缺乏安全性
Redis并不提供數(shù)據(jù)的安全性保障,這也是Redis的另一個缺點。 數(shù)據(jù)可以直接讀寫,沒有訪問控制和身份驗證。這使得Redis缺乏統(tǒng)一管理能力,增加了系統(tǒng)的安全隱患。
四、Redis缺乏良好的監(jiān)控和管理工具
Redis缺乏良好的監(jiān)控和管理工具,這使得它在運維過程中比較麻煩。如果有多個Redis節(jié)點,需要手動管理和監(jiān)控,不能做到自動化管理。 這也降低了Redis的可操作性和可維護性。
綜上,Redis的缺陷主要表現(xiàn)在存儲引擎不夠穩(wěn)定、缺乏分布式特性、缺乏安全性以及缺乏良好的監(jiān)控和管理工具的問題。為了解決這些問題,我們需要給Redis提供強勁的源動力。下面將介紹一些改善Redis的建議。
建議一:更換存儲引擎
為了解決Redis存儲引擎不夠穩(wěn)定的問題,我們可以通過更換存儲引擎的方式來增強其穩(wěn)定性。雖然Redis原生存儲引擎依然具有適用性,但是未來的存儲引擎將會更加智能化和高效化。例如,RocksDB是目前比較流行的存儲引擎,具有高性能、高可靠性和易擴展性的優(yōu)點。
建議二:引入分布式特性
為了解決Redis缺乏分布式特性的問題,我們可以通過引入分布式特性來實現(xiàn)數(shù)據(jù)的自動化復制、數(shù)據(jù)的分區(qū)和負載均衡等功能。這樣就可以提高Redis的可用性和可擴展性。例如,采用分布式鎖、分布式存儲等技術,可以實現(xiàn)分布式緩存集群的搭建。
建議三:提高安全性
為了提高Redis的安全性,我們可以通過安裝Redis的安全插件和SSL證書來保障數(shù)據(jù)安全。另外,我們也可以通過訪問控制和數(shù)據(jù)加密機制等方式,來保障Redis系統(tǒng)的安全性。
建議四:引入自動化運維
為了提高Redis的運維效率,我們可以采用官方推薦的Redis Cluster或第三方管理工具,實現(xiàn)Redis節(jié)點的監(jiān)控、管理和自動化運維。這樣不僅可以提高Redis的可操作性和可維護性,還可以減少運維成本。
我們需要認識到Redis的缺陷,并積極尋求解決方式。只有通過持續(xù)不斷地優(yōu)化,才能使Redis更加強大和可靠,更好地服務于人們的需求。
成都服務器托管選創(chuàng)新互聯(lián),先上架開通再付費。
創(chuàng)新互聯(lián)(www.cdcxhl.com)專業(yè)-網(wǎng)站建設,軟件開發(fā)老牌服務商!微信小程序開發(fā),APP開發(fā),網(wǎng)站制作,網(wǎng)站營銷推廣服務眾多企業(yè)。電話:028-86922220
網(wǎng)站欄目:Redis缺乏強勁的源動力(redis 源不夠)
文章分享:http://m.fisionsoft.com.cn/article/djhjsod.html


咨詢
建站咨詢
